Hey — handing off the Matchforge GC investigation before your security review. Short version: the matching service pauses for up to 1.2s under peak load, and during those pauses the auth token refresh can time out, which is why you're seeing the re-auth storms in the logs. Nothing malicious, just heap pressure. We bumped the young-gen size and switched collectors last week, which mostly fixed it, but please sanity-check that the token TTLs still make sense against worst-case pauses. Current production tuning is as follows.

settings of yageg-yahap:
[gorael]
team = olieth
access_code = ac_941d74
owner = brieth.aldiel
host = gorael.tolvaqio.internal
port = 6379
peer = briwyn.urlaqtech.internal
salt = 116e6622
pin = 1957

Subject: Inventory reconciliation — on-call basics

Welcome aboard. The Stockline reconciliation job runs nightly at 02:00 and compares warehouse counts against the ledger. If it fails, rerun once. If it fails twice, page the data team — don't edit counts manually. Alerts land in the ops channel. Runbook, rerun command, and escalation contacts are on the page below.

dashboard of kajep-tajog = https://harbor.tolvaqworks.example/pipeline/run/dash/pipeline/228e278bbf9b3bc2

## PortionPilot basics

PortionPilot scales recipes by ratio with unit conversion baked in. Releases cut biweekly from main; the scaling engine and unit tables version independently. Release manager checklist: verify conversion-table hash, run the rounding regression suite, tag both components. The full release checklist lives here.

operations page: https://jenkins.zemvarcloud.local/job/merge_requests/repo/build/73930b4b30f0a8ed

## Runbook: Account recovery — Glazemap tile cache

If the service account for the Glazemap tile-rendering cache gets locked (usually after failed warm-up auth retries), don't just spam resets — that extends the lockout. Flush the `tilecache-warm` queue first, then run the recovery flow from the bastion. When prompted by the recovery tool, enter the passphrase shown directly below.

unlock words, hahip-baduf: holwyn-istath-julvan